Remember, the metrics that you use to measure ROI on different marketing channels will depend on your goals and objectives.
With that in mind, here is a quick list of metrics that you can use to measure digital marketing ROI based on the tactics you use:
• Email – Open rate, click-through rate, bounce rate, unsubscribe rate, conversions, and leads acquired.
• Social Media – Engagement rates, clicks and click-through rate, conversions, leads acquired, and new fans or followers. like that LinkedIn, Instragram
• Landing Pages – Traffic, unique visitors, returning visitors, total page views, time spent on page, actions taken, and conversions.
• Blogs – Traffic, clicks, time spent on page, unique visitors, returning visitors, actions are taken, and conversions.
